Traditional advertising methods often miss the mark with tourists. A billboard on a local highway might be seen by residents, but it won’t reach someone in another country planning their vacation. This is where a modern approach to travel audience marketing F&B comes in. By leveraging data and technology, businesses can identify individuals who have booked flights or hotels to their city. This allows for a hyper-targeted and proactive marketing strategy. Instead of waiting for tourists to stumble upon your restaurant, you can present your unique offerings to them directly on their social media feeds, through email campaigns, or on travel-related websites.
